2. Factors Influencing Crypto Prices:
a. Regulatory Environment:
The regulatory landscape plays a crucial role in the crypto market. Governments around the world are still trying to figure out how to regulate cryptocurrencies without stifling innovation. Positive regulatory news can boost investor confidence and drive prices higher.
b. Technological Advancements:
Innovations in blockchain technology, such as the development of new protocols and improved scalability solutions, can positively impact the market. These advancements can attract more investors and increase the demand for cryptocurrencies, potentially leading to higher prices.
c. Market Sentiment:
Market sentiment is a powerful driver of cryptocurrency prices. Positive news, such as mainstream adoption by large corporations or countries, can create a bullish market environment. Conversely, negative news, such as hacks or scams, can lead to a bearish market.
d. Economic Factors:
Economic factors, such as inflation, interest rates, and currency fluctuations, can also influence crypto prices. For instance, during periods of high inflation, investors may turn to cryptocurrencies as a hedge against traditional fiat currencies.

4. Risks and Challenges:
a. Regulatory Risks:
The crypto market remains highly susceptible to regulatory changes. Any negative news regarding regulations could lead to a significant drop in prices.
b. Market Manipulation:
Market manipulation is a persistent issue in the crypto market. This can lead to volatility and make it difficult to predict future price movements.
c. Security Concerns:
Cybersecurity threats are a significant concern in the crypto market. Hacks and thefts can lead to a loss of investor confidence and a subsequent drop in prices.
